Preview Mode Links will not work in preview mode

Imperial College Podcast

Feb 17, 2021

In this edition: What testing on transport says about coronavirus transmission, how new virus variants are emerging, and chatting to a cardiologist.

News: Dragonfly flight, making audio more immersive and landing on Mars – We hear how dragonflies perform mid-air backward somersaults to right themselves, why making